Cormelles-le-Royal, Basse-Normandie: Urban and Rural Cycling Adventures


Cycling routes from Cormelles-le-Royal

Cormelles-le-Royal in Basse-Normandie, France is a decent locality for road and gravel cyclists. The region offers a mix of urban and rural roads, with some rolling hills to add fun and challenge to the rides. The roads are generally in good condition, but there can be moderate traffic in certain areas. Cormelles-le-Royal itself doesn't have any famous cycling spots or well-known climbs, but it provides easy access to larger towns and cities in the Basse-Normandie region. Cyclists can explore the scenic Norman countryside and visit historical sites along the way. Overall, Cormelles-le-Royal ranks 3 in terms of cycling friendliness and offers enjoyable rides for cyclists.
